This will launch the man program and display every bit of information that you need
to know about the ls program.
The man ls command
To move around the man program, you can use the arrow keys on your keyboard.
If you wish to skip the whole page, you can press the spacebar key. When you have
finished reading the information, you can exit by pressing the q key.
Don't forget that Linux is a case-sensitive operating system and it
is extremely important that you use the correct case when you are
running the command.
The autocompletion of commands
One of the most useful features of bash is its ability to autocomplete the name of the
command that you are typing. This is as easy as pressing the Tab key.
